Addressing sun damage and environmental skin concerns
Many people visit clinics for treatments such as laser resurfacing and advanced light therapy in hopes of reversing years of sun and environmental damage. These steps will eliminate redness, brown spots, and fine lines, giving you smoother, clearer skin. According to National Cancer InstituteExposure to UV rays causes cumulative skin damage that accumulates over many years. That’s why professional-level treatment can make such a noticeable difference. The combination of pollution and environmental stressors further exacerbates the damage.
Clinics have access to much more powerful technology than regular stores, resulting in faster and more dramatic results. National Institutes of Health research Ablative and non-ablative laser resurfacing has been confirmed to be a safe and effective tool when performed by qualified professionals.
